Lines Matching refs:buffer
713 unsigned char buffer[], int size) in sb1000_print_status_buffer() argument
718 if (buffer[24] == 0x08 && buffer[25] == 0x00 && buffer[26] == 0x45) { in sb1000_print_status_buffer()
720 "to %d.%d.%d.%d:%d\n", name, buffer[28] << 8 | buffer[29], in sb1000_print_status_buffer()
721 buffer[35], buffer[38], buffer[39], buffer[40], buffer[41], in sb1000_print_status_buffer()
722 buffer[46] << 8 | buffer[47], in sb1000_print_status_buffer()
723 buffer[42], buffer[43], buffer[44], buffer[45], in sb1000_print_status_buffer()
724 buffer[48] << 8 | buffer[49]); in sb1000_print_status_buffer()
729 printk(" %02x", buffer[k]); in sb1000_print_status_buffer()
746 unsigned char st[2], buffer[FRAMESIZE], session_id, frame_id; in sb1000_rx() local
811 insw(ioaddr, buffer, NewDatagramHeaderSize / 2); in sb1000_rx()
813 …dentification: %02x%02x fragment offset: %02x%02x\n", buffer[30], buffer[31], buffer[32], buffer[… in sb1000_rx()
815 if (buffer[0] != NewDatagramHeaderSkip) { in sb1000_rx()
818 "got %02x expecting %02x\n", dev->name, buffer[0], in sb1000_rx()
821 insw(ioaddr, buffer, NewDatagramDataSize / 2); in sb1000_rx()
824 dlen = ((buffer[NewDatagramHeaderSkip + 3] & 0x0f) << 8 | in sb1000_rx()
825 buffer[NewDatagramHeaderSkip + 4]) - 17; in sb1000_rx()
831 insw(ioaddr, buffer, NewDatagramDataSize / 2); in sb1000_rx()
842 insw(ioaddr, buffer, NewDatagramDataSize / 2); in sb1000_rx()
847 skb->protocol = (unsigned short) buffer[NewDatagramHeaderSkip + 16]; in sb1000_rx()
853 insw(ioaddr, buffer, ContDatagramHeaderSize / 2); in sb1000_rx()
854 if (buffer[0] != ContDatagramHeaderSkip) { in sb1000_rx()
857 "got %02x expecting %02x\n", dev->name, buffer[0], in sb1000_rx()
860 insw(ioaddr, buffer, ContDatagramDataSize / 2); in sb1000_rx()
883 insw(ioaddr, buffer, FrameSize / 2); in sb1000_rx()
890 sb1000_print_status_buffer(dev->name, st, buffer, FrameSize); in sb1000_rx()